Question No Heat, it's 15 degrees outside, I'm freezing

My wife has a 1997 Audi A4 - 6 cyl. The heat is not working properly. Even with the heat on high it barely blows lukewarm air. Her mechanic told her that it is some kind of module that controls that and several other functions and the module itself costs around $400 - $500. Are there things I can check myself to see if it's something else. Can those free diagnostic checks they do at PepBoys tell me what the problem is? There is anti freeze in the radiator and the heat works a little but just barely.

Does it show regular 90C as engine temp when idling and then it goes down when you start driving? My A4 was like that year ago when I bought it.

Then it could be thermostat, good news is it doesn't cost much. Bad news is, at least in my 2.6 v6, the timing belt had to be removed in order to access that thermostat. It is a good excuse to replace belt too, it isn't expensive either. Just that few hours of work costs.
